Output e684c24c0babd3e701cc04b1284c4dbe4212bdd031c396cafbd36ba01cd33c2a:2

value
8375886
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ea99cb933a4608db0b849a7f3413bf62eb323bad OP_EQUAL
address
MVHcbCQJYoXf92WGmWqzxuD3B3gZTSG611
transaction
e684c24c0babd3e701cc04b1284c4dbe4212bdd031c396cafbd36ba01cd33c2a
spent
true